The breeding tips of moth and butterfly flower

Sowing time

The sowing and propagation of moth and butterfly flower is mainly carried out in autumn, from late August to early October.

Soil for sowing

For the sowing propagation of moth and butterfly flower, you can choose a mixture of leaf mold, garden soil and chaff ash as the medium for the seedbed for sowing. Before sowing moth and butterfly flowers, the seedbed needs to be watered sufficiently, and then sowing can be carried out after the water has penetrated.

Seed propagation of moth butterfly flower

How to sow

Sprinkle the prepared moth and butterfly flower seeds evenly on the prepared soil, and sprinkle a layer of soil on top of the seeds. Since the seeds of the moth flower are relatively large, the final covering soil should also be thicker, not less than 3mm.

Post-sowing management of moth and butterfly flower

Moth and butterfly flower is propagated by sowing, and seedlings will usually emerge about a week after sowing. Before the seedlings emerge, it is necessary to build a shade net on the seedbed to provide shade, which can reduce temperature and retain moisture. After the seedlings emerge, the shade net should be removed to ensure that the young seedlings of moth orchid receive sufficient light. In the early stages of seedling growth, watering needs to be controlled. Divide the seedlings in time and control the growth height of the moth and butterfly flower plants.

Transplanting and planting

Basically, when the moth flower seedlings grow 3-4 leaves, they can be divided and transplanted. First use a smaller pot to grow seedlings, shade them, and then give them normal light after the seedlings have grown.

When the seedlings of moth orchid grow 6-7 leaves, they can be potted. Flower pots with a diameter of about 15 cm are generally used, and it is best to keep the original soil when transplanting.
